Prague is a great city too - I have spent a total of about 30 weeks there in the last 10 years. Mosquitoes wont be a problem in Prague, but it will be colder and darker. The restaurant under the Opera will be good for dinner; there is a museum of beer which is good for the Thursday night meet up, lunch on Saturday could be in an out of the way spot (2 stops on metro from the centre) in Vysyrad which is also a photogenic location to start. 1 4 Link to post Share on other sites More sharing options...
